Backpacking: Our Ultimate Prep-for-the-Season Guide

Ready to hit the trail? You might be eager to get out and into the hinterlands, but is your gear all set? If it’s been a while since your backpacking equipment has seen light beyond the gear closet, it might be wise to inspect it and ensure that it’s ready to support you in the back of beyond—before you head out.

Here’s a list of resources that can help. These articles cover everything from performing annual maintenance checks to tips for keeping your gear running smoothly in the field, and even how to choose the right gear for a particular trip. If you haven’t been out already, we hope your first backpacking trip is right around the corner!
